Meadow Vista is an older-stock pocket of Fort Myers, with a median build year of 1963 inside a range that stretches from 1925 up to 2022. That spread means the 281 homes here are not uniform: some are original mid-century construction, others are recent infill or rebuilds, and condition — not just size — is doing most of the work in how any one listing is priced.
With a median living area of 1,356 square feet, this is a compact-home market by current build standards. Buyers should expect to evaluate each property on its own renovation history rather than assume a consistent baseline across the community, and sellers should lean on updates and documentation to differentiate from older, unmodified inventory nearby.

The market around Meadow Vista
Meadow Vista is too small for its own price trend, so here is the market around it.
In ZIP 33901, 18 homes are on the market and 11% are under contract — a slower corner of Fort Myers.
Across Lee County, 689 homes are active and 139 pending (17% under contract).
The housing mix here is 94% singlefamilyresidence, 6% duplex.
ZIP and county figures describe the wider market, not Meadow Vista specifically. Momentum Research analysis of MLS records.

A Market Defined by Vintage Mix
The nearly hundred-year build span — 1925 to 2022 — is the defining structural fact about Meadow Vista. A median year built of 1963 confirms the core of the community is established, but the presence of homes built as recently as 2022 shows ongoing infill or rebuilding activity alongside the older housing stock. For buyers, this means two similarly sized homes on nearby streets can carry very different systems, finishes, and maintenance needs.
Homestead exemption is filed on close to 40 percent of homes here, meaning a meaningful share of the community is owner-occupied on a longer-term basis, while a majority of properties are not currently homesteaded. No community amenities are identified in current MLS listings, so this reads as a straightforward residential area valued for its homes and location rather than for shared recreational infrastructure.
